Does a 1999 Chevy Suburban have a cabin air filter?

1999 Chevy Suburban and Cabin Air Filter
Based on the research, it appears that the 1999 Chevy Suburban does not have a cabin air filter. Instead, vehicles without cabin air filters typically have a plastic mesh that prevents leaves and other foreign objects from entering the HVAC system. This mesh is part of the vehicle and does not need to be changed.
It’s worth noting that while some newer vehicles have cabin air filters located on the passenger side of the vehicle and behind the glove box, the 1999 Chevy Suburban did not come equipped with one. However, it is possible to install a cabin air filter, as indicated by a technical service bulletin, but this would require cutting a section of the air duct.
In summary, the 1999 Chevy Suburban does not come with a cabin air filter as part of its original equipment, but it is possible to install one with the appropriate modifications.

What if there is no cabin air filter?

If the AC is used for long enough sans cabin filter, the fan blower will get clogged up with dirt and dust much faster. This can lead to issues related to low air flow, such as lack of cooling, a frozen evaporator and a frozen expansion valve.
